Abstract

A process is described for non-cyclic paraffin isomerization under strong acid conditions in which an adamantane hydrocarbon is used to substantially increase the reaction rate of the isomerization.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An isomerization process comprising contacting a C 4  -C 6  non-cyclic paraffinic hydrocarbon with a strong acid system .Iadd.selected from HBr, HF, HCl, H 2  SO 4 , HSO 3  F, CF 3  SO 3  H and mixture thereof .Iaddend.in the presence of an adamantane hydrocarbon containing at least one unsubstituted bridgehead position, .Iadd.wherein the molar concentration of the adamantane hydrocarbon in solution in the paraffin hydrocarbon is from about 0.1M to 1M .Iaddend.at a temperature of about -100° to 150° C., thereby producing a branched isomer of said paraffinic hydrocarbon. 
     
     
       2. The process of claim 1 wherein said paraffinic hydrocarbon is selected from n-butane, n-pentane, n-hexane, 2-methylpentane, 3-methylpentane isomers thereof, and mixtures thereof. .[.3. The process of claim 1 wherein said acid system contains an acid component selected from AlCl 3 , AlBr 3 , GaCl 3 , TaF 5 , SbF 5 , AsF 5 , BF 3 , HBr, HF, HCl, H 2  SO 4 , HSO 3  F, CF 3  SO 3   
     
     
        H, and mixtures thereof..]. 4. The process of claim .[.3.]. .Iadd.1 .Iaddend.wherein said acid system further contains a solvent selected from CH 3  Br, CH 2  Br 2 , CH 2  Cl 2 , 1,2-dichloroethane, 1,2,3-trichlorobenzene, 1,2,3,4-tetrachlorobenzene, pentafluorobenzene; HF, H 2  SO 4 , HSO 3  F, CF 3  SO 3  H, and mixtures 
     
     
        thereof. 5. The process of claim 1 wherein said adamantane hydrocarbon is 
     
     
        unsubstituted adamantane. 6. The process of claim 1 wherein said 
     
     
        temperature is in the range of about -50° to 100° C. 7. The 
     
     
        process of claim 1 being conducted in a continuous manner. 8. The process of claim 1 wherein said paraffin is 3-methylpentane and said product is 2-methylpentane. .[.9. The process of claim 3 wherein said strong acid 
     
     
        system contains AlCl 3 , AlBr 3 , GaCl 3  or TaF 5 ..]. 10. The process of claim 1 wherein said paraffin is n-butane and said 
     
     
        product is isobutane. 11. The process of claim 1 wherein said paraffin is 
     
     
        n-pentane and said product is isopentane. 12. The process of claim 1 wherein said paraffin is n-hexane and said product is a mixture of C 6   
     
     
        isomers containing more than 20 weight percent 2.2-dimethylbutane. 13. The process of claim 1 wherein said paraffin is a mixture of C 4 , C 5  or C 6  isomers wherein at least one fraction is not at thermodynamic equilibrium.
